In this case, the inverter draws 3000 watts of power, and the battery bank is 12 volts. . System Voltage Optimization: While 12V systems are common for RVs, 24V and 48V configurations significantly reduce DC current requirements for 3000W applications – from 250+ amps at 12V down to just 65 amps at 48V, enabling smaller wire sizes and reduced installation costs. A microgrid is a group of interconnected loads and distributed energy resources within clearly defined electrical boundaries that acts as a single controllable entity with respect to the grid. 2 A microgrid can operate in either grid-connected or in island mode, including entirely off-grid. .
